Saltwick, the internal quoting tool, slips eight weeks. Cause: data migration defects found by the Harrowgate team. Decision: no added headcount; scope trimmed, reporting module deferred. Sales leads continue on the legacy Pricewheel system until cutover. Imrie owns the revised timeline; Kavanagh owns comms to regional teams. No customer-facing messaging about the tool. Next checkpoint in three weeks. Escalations go to Droste directly. The strategic backdrop is summarized in the confidential note below.

confidential, kagup-bafog: Fraaxax Group is in early talks to buy Soroxox Group for about $343.8 million. The Olidor launch date is June 14, and nothing goes to the press before then. Legal wants the Aldmirek Logistics term sheet signed before July 23.

## Changelog — InvoiceForge 4.2.0: Changed defaults

For anyone new to the team: InvoiceForge renders customer-facing PDF invoices, so default changes here are customer-visible. In 4.2.0 we switched the default page size, tightened font embedding, and reduced the render worker pool to match observed load. Older templates continue to work, but any pipeline pinned to 4.1.x defaults should be reviewed before upgrading. The new shipped defaults are listed below.

settings of kageg-yawig:
[casix]
host = casix.tolvaqlabs.corp
user = casix_svc
database = casix_prod

## Nightly Reindex — Limits and Quotas

The Lanternfish search cluster rebuilds its index nightly from the primary store. Reviewers changing the pipeline should keep total runtime under the four-hour maintenance window and respect per-tenant document quotas, since oversized tenants previously starved the queue. Throttles apply at both the fetch and commit stages; exceeding either aborts the tenant's batch, not the whole run. The enforced limits are:

tuning constants:
RATE_LIMITS = {
    "goriel": 284,
    "brieth": 236,
    "lamvan": 916,
    "druok": 255,
    "wenion": 979,
    "istmir": 343,
    "queniel": 302,
}